That is soo true.
Look at some of the old square RPGs.
8 bit graphics, horible rendering, but the story is so compeling that it just drives you in more and more.
Although lately I have seem many game makers abandoning story, be it linear or non, for graphics which is sad, but I must say that sometimes those FMVs do make the game sort of come alive.

Anyway back to topic, I say both are good.
Linear since it makes it simpler to play
Non Linear since it makes it more interesting to play
